(Image: https://images.pexels.com/photos/33079719/pexels-photo-33079719.jpeg)These a number of biochemical reactions converge to help the motion of intracellular vesicles containing facilitative glucose transporters to the cell membrane. In the absence of insulin, these transport proteins are usually recycled slowly between the cell membrane and cell inside. Insulin triggers the rapid movement of a pool of glucose transporter vesicles to the cell membrane, the place they fuse and expose the glucose transporters to the extracellular fluid. The transporters then transfer glucose by facilitated diffusion into the cell inside. Visit this hyperlink to view an animation describing the location and operate of the pancreas. Up to now crucial functional role ascribed to lactate has been that of facilitating learning and reminiscence. Initial studies in 1 day previous chick demonstrated that exposure to an experimental paradigm designed to invoke studying resulted in a lower in glycogen, and a temporally correlated elevation in interstitial glutamate, suggesting that studying promotes glycogen metabolism to provide glutamate, an anaplerotic response, that's subsequently important to the learning protocol. The memory consolidation was attenuated when glycolysis was inhibited by way of the used of iodoacetate or 2-deoxyglucose, results that could possibly be circumvented by the applying of acetate, which is produced by astrocytes. Blocking glycogen metabolism via the use of DAB, an inhibitor of glycogen phosphorylase, attenuated the educational course of, which might once more be circumvented by the addition of glutamine, aspartate or acetate. The general scheme that emerged was one through which the memory storage within the chick includes three distinct processes, (1) brief term recall, (2) intermediate reminiscence, and (3) reminiscence consolidation into long-term reminiscence (O’Dowd et al., 1994; Hertz et al., 1996, 2003; Gibbs et al., 2006a, b).
